The song was originally done by Sonny Landreth, who is probably the greatest slide guitar player ever, and has been acclaimed by Eric Clapton as "the most underestimated musician on the planet". Landreth's most recent album features him playing guitar duets with Clapton, Eric Johnson, Mark Knopfler, and Robben Ford.

Landreth describes the song thusly:

After driving a small car for years, my friends were impressed when I inherited my parents’ old ’82 Oldsmobile 98 – 'It’s as big as a boat!' We’d pile in and run the roads to dance halls and zydeco clubs in places like Opelousas, Lawtell, Frilot Cove and Dog Hill. Once, at the end of a long night, I was digging for my keys and almost got into the wrong car. When I stepped back out onto the road, I could see a whole fleet of zydecoldsmobiles lined up and parked along Highway 90. A car that size won’t stretch your gas mileage, but at least you can dance on the trunk.
